More about Jungkook's Seven

Seven (feat. Latto) is a pre-release track from Jungkook’s first solo album, GOLDEN. The song, along with a cinematic music video, was unveiled on July 14, 2023. The following day, a performance video was also released.

Seven comes in three different versions: a clean, an explicit, and an instrumental one. The song explores a combination of diverse rhythm, atmospheres, and melody.

From UK Garage to acoustic guitar, the addictive sound swiftly synchronizes with Jungkook’s sweet vocals, enhancing the overall quality. On the other hand, his synergy with rapper Latto brings out the liveliness of this track, making it a massive hit.

Seven stayed atop Billboard Global 200 and Hot 100 for many weeks, demonstrating the singer’s global influence. Recently, it became the first song by an Asian soloist to have exceeded 1.7 billion streams on Spotify and the official music video has also surpassed 400 million views on YouTube.

Catch up on Jungkook's latest activities

Jungkook is currently completing his mandatory military service, which he enlisted on December 12, 2023, alongside bandmate Jimin. The duo is likely to be discharged on June 11, 2025. 

On the work front, on June 7, the Golden maknae released a new solo song, Never Let Go, as the song for BTS FESTA 2024, marking the group’s 11th debut anniversary on June 13. His last official solo album, GOLDEN, was released on November 3, 2023.
